Is this recipe gluten free?

Yes! This recipe is made with oats, not flour so if you have a gluten allergy or are looking for a healthier option, this is a great one!

Can these muffins be frozen?

Yes! Allow to fully cool after baking before placing in a freezer bag or container. I love to make these ahead for the week and freeze, they reheat perfectly like they were made fresh that day!

Are old fashioned or quick cooking oats better?

I have made this recipe with both old fashion oats and quick cooking oats many times and they are equally delicious. The biggest difference is the texture, it just comes down to your personal preference!

Baked Oatmeal Mixed Berry Muffins

Prep Time 15 minutes
Cook Time 22 minutes
Course Breakfast
Cuisine American
Servings 12 muffins

Equipment

  • Standard 12 cup muffin tin
  • Small saucepan
  • Muffin cup liners (if you are not greasing the pan)

Ingredients
  

  • 1 cup cooked strawberries and blueberries (or mixed berries of choice) with juice from cooking
  • 1 1/2 cups old fashioned oats can use quick cooking or old fashioned
  • 3/4 cup milk
  • 1/4 cup packed light brown sugar
  • 1/4 cup maple syrup
  • 1 large egg
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ract
  • 1 1/2 tsp cinnamon
  • 1 tsp baking powder
  • 1/2 tsp salt
  • Add 1/2 cup chopped walnuts, if desired

Instructions
 

  • Cook frozen strawberries and blueberries in a small saucepan over medium-low heat for 10-12 minutes, stirring frequently (if using whole strawberries, cut up after cooked)
  • Preheat the oven to 350°F
  • Combine all ingredients in a large bowl
  • Divide batter into muffin tin (grease pan or use muffin cup liners) – batter will fill 12 muffin cups about 3/4 full
  • Cook for about 22-24 minutes or until toothpick comes out clean
